St Petersburg is the former capital of Russia and is the second largest city in the Russian Federation, offering a fantastic cosmopolitan and vibrant atmosphere as well boasting some of the most beautiful architecture in Europe.
Bursting with abundance of culture, history & heritage – St Petersburg offers a spectacular range of Museums and Cathedrals including the largest cathedral in Russia - Saint Iscaac’s as well as Peter & Paul’s Cathedral, the second tallest building in Russia behind the Mercure City Tower.

Saint Petersburg, Russia
This city is rich with grand and graceful palaces such as the Mikhailovskiy Palace, the Marble Palace and most famously – the Winter Palace, St Petersburg’s most finest and one of the greatest royal residencies in the world which includes the famous Hermitage Museum.
St Petersburg is also home to the Church of the Savior on Spilt Blood other known as the Church of Resurrection of Jesus Christ, a fantastically engineered and designed vocal point of the city, which first opened up in 1907, dedicated to former Emperor, Alexander II.
As well as exploring the teeming history and culture of the city, why not take a therapeutic walk along the banks of the romantic Neva River admiring the sheer beauty of the architecture, bridges and large ships on offer.
This fascinating city also has a brilliant range of restaurants and bars from traditional Russian cuisine in stately surrounding to a wide choice of international flavours with modern twists on rooftop terraces with panoramic views of St Petersburg.
